Trump's FEMA Pick Remains Unannounced Amid California Wildfires
With California facing devastating wildfires, President-elect Donald Trump has yet to announce his pick for the crucial role of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) administrator. This leaves a critical position unfilled during a major natural disaster.
While Trump has a history of unpredictable announcements, he has instead focused on blaming California officials for the fires, despite lacking evidence. Meanwhile, Kevin Guthrie, executive director of the Florida Division of Emergency Management, has emerged as the frontrunner for the FEMA job.
Guthrie has extensive experience in emergency management, having led Florida's response to major hurricanes and a deadly condo collapse. He is widely respected across the political spectrum for his competence and nonpartisan approach.
Trump's transition team began considering Guthrie last week, sending a clear signal to Florida's political world. Many believe he is the likely pick, given his qualifications and the lack of other strong contenders.
While California is more prone to wildfires than Florida, Guthrie's experience in hurricane response is seen as valuable. He has also demonstrated an ability to work effectively in a politically charged environment, which could be crucial given Trump's penchant for controversy.
The wildfires have caused widespread devastation, with 24 fatalities and thousands of structures destroyed. Federal agencies are currently covering for the lack of a political appointee at FEMA, but a confirmed administrator is needed to provide long-term leadership and support.
Trump has not publicly discussed his plans for wildfire aid, but reports suggest he may link it to raising the debt ceiling, a move that has drawn criticism from Democrats.
Newsom has invited Trump to survey the damage and has expressed hope for collaboration, while praising Biden's response to the crisis. It remains to be seen whether Trump will prioritize addressing the wildfire crisis or engage in political maneuvering.
